    <title>2010 (8) TMI 821 - MADHYA PRADESH HIGH COURT</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=164157</link>
    <description>Section 3 of the Madhya Pradesh Entry Tax Act was treated as the complete charging provision: the taxable event is entry of specified goods into a local area in the course of business, the dealer is the person liable, and the rate is supplied by the Schedule. The Court held that the reference to dealers liable under the VAT Act identifies the person from whom tax is recovered and does not restrict the levy. It further held that section 3B is only a special collection mechanism, so the absence of a notification under that provision does not defeat the charge or exclude recovery through the general machinery under section 14.</description>
